Common causes include slow startup after a deploy, exhausted connection pools on the Orvana service, or a misconfigured health-check path after a route change. First steps: check the deploy timeline, confirm the /healthz endpoint responds within 2 seconds, and verify node registration in the balancer console. If the cause is unclear after 15 minutes, escalate to the platform reliability group at the address below.

escalation mailbox, bafog-fafog: ulador@paliqlabs.internal

## Limits and Quotas

The Quillmark rendering pipeline enforces hard caps on every plugin invocation to protect shared workers. Exceeding any cap aborts the render and returns a structured error; plugins should degrade gracefully rather than retry immediately. These caps apply per document, not per plugin, so chained transforms share the same budget. The enforced limits are listed below.

tuning constants:
RATE_LIMITS = {
    "ralwyn": 2,
    "druath": 10,
    "ralix": 1,
    "quenath": 10,
}

- [ ] Step 7: Archive cold storage buckets (Glacierline tier). Confirm both ceremony witnesses are present, verify bucket manifests match the Oxbow ledger, then seal the archive key shares. Plugin authors may observe but not handle shares. Once sealed, the archive index itself is encrypted and can only be reopened with the passphrase below.

vault phrase of badup-hahig = tamael-aldael-kelmir-istael-fenok-istwyn-tamius-jorath-oliion

Team — quick note before Thursday's sync. Config hot-reload for the Fennel gateway now picks up credential changes without a restart, so the old Lattice service key is being retired today. Watchers on the config bus will swap automatically; anything reading the cached value must re-fetch within the hour. The replacement key for the Lattice internal API follows below.

app token of kajop-tahag = qvz23-qaEp6MzrfP2AwhVbZwsZeUq